Taming the Beast: Effective Salesforce License Cost Management Strategies

Effective optimization of Salesforce licenses is crucial for businesses regardless of industry. As your company expands, controlling these costs can become increasingly difficult. A well-defined strategy can dramatically reduce expenses while ensuring your team has the access they need to succeed.

  • Conduct an in-depth assessment of your current Salesforce usage. Identify users who are utilizing the platform regularly, and those who may no longer require access.
  • Explore alternative licensing models that better align your company's needs, such as user-based or group-based licenses.
  • Leverage automation tools to simplify the license approval process. This can help prevent overallocation.

Regularly review your licensing configuration to ensure it remains optimized. Adjust your strategy as your business changes.

Embracing Your Business Growth With Salesforce Editions

Choosing the optimal Salesforce edition can seem like a daunting challenge. With various editions tailored to different organizational sizes and needs, finding your perfect fit is crucial for optimizing Salesforce's full potential.

Start by analyzing your current operational workflows. Consider the scale of your team, your budget constraints, and the specific functionalities you require. Are you a small business needing basic CRM functionalities? Or a large enterprise requiring advanced customization and integration options?

  • Comprehending your current needs will help you narrow down the choices. Salesforce offers a range of editions, from the basic Essentials to the Advanced and the Unlimited. Each edition comes with distinct advantages and limitations
  • Keep in mind that your needs may evolve over time. Choose an edition that allows for future development and can handle your evolving business requirements.

Don't hesitate to speak with a Salesforce expert or partner. They can provide valuable insights and suggestions based on your specific context

Uncover Hidden Costs: Conducting a Comprehensive Salesforce License Audit

A well-executed Salesforce license audit can identify hidden costs and ensure your organization is utilizing its resources effectively. Implementing a thorough audit involves reviewing user permissions, pinpointing unused licenses, and reconciling your current usage with your subscription obligations.

  • A comprehensive audit can reveal potential efficiencies by eliminating redundant or unused licenses.
  • With evaluating user behavior, you can determine the actual demand for specific features.

Optimize Risk and Save Money with Proactive Salesforce License Management

In today's dynamic business environment, strategically managing your Salesforce licenses is crucial for both minimizing risk and maximizing cost savings. By adopting a proactive approach to license management, you can prevent unnecessary expenses and ensure that your organization has the correct number of licenses to meet its needs. A comprehensive framework for Salesforce license management involves regularly reviewing user activity, identifying unused accounts, and optimizing your license allocation based on real-time data. This proactive method can help you reduce overall licensing costs while ensuring that your teams have access to the necessary tools and resources for success.

  • Leverage automated tools to monitor user activity and identify potential cost savings opportunities.
  • Establish a clear process for acquiring new licenses and removing unused ones.
  • Work together with your Salesforce administrator to formulate an effective license management strategy that meets your organization's specific requirements.

Unlocking Efficiency: Salesforce Licensing Best Practices for Growth

As your business proliferates, optimizing your Salesforce licensing can be crucial for ensuring efficiency and maximizing ROI. Implement best practices to ensure you have the right users with the appropriate permissions. A well-structured licensing strategy will optimize workflows, boost productivity, and ultimately drive revenue growth.

To effectively manage your Salesforce licenses, consider these key strategies:

  • Periodically review user roles and permissions to eliminate redundancies and ensure users only have access to the data and features they require.
  • Employ Salesforce's reporting and analytics tools to gain insights into user activity and identify areas for enhancement.
  • Incorporate a tiered licensing model that aligns with different user groups and their specific needs.
  • Continue updated on new Salesforce features and releases to ensure you are taking full advantage of your investment.

By embracing these best practices, you can unlock the full potential of your Salesforce system, paving the way for sustainable growth and success.
